EY, formerly Ernst & Young, operates a global network delivering assurance, tax, transaction, and advisory services. The designation "EYTC" typically refers to EY Technology Consulting, while "CS" denotes Cyber Security, and "DPP" stands for Data Privacy and Protection. A Senior role within this vertical means you will be expected to lead client engagements, translate regulatory complexity into actionable controls, and mentor junior team members.

Building a CV That Survives the EY Screening Funnel
The competition for Big Four advisory positions is intense. To stand out, your curriculum vitae must reflect both depth in privacy law and pragmatic delivery experience. Consider the following bulleted essentials:
- Demonstrated experience with cross-border data transfer mechanisms such as Standard Contractual Clauses or Binding Corporate Rules.
- Certifications like IAPP's CIPP/E, CIPM, or India-specific DCPP credentials.
- Exposure to privacy impact assessments, data mapping, and remediation projects.
- Ability to communicate with regulators, auditors, and business stakeholders.
- Prior consulting or implementation experience in cloud environments (AWS, Azure) with privacy guardrails.
- Understanding of automated data discovery tools and tokenization techniques.

Strategic Preparation for the Interview and Case Study
EY's hiring for advisory roles often includes a case study simulating a privacy breach or a compliance gap. Prepare by rehearsing structured problem solving: identify the data inventory, classify sensitivity, evaluate legal obligations, and propose a remediation roadmap. Use the STAR (Situation, Task, Action, Result) method to narrate past successes.
Success in privacy consulting is less about memorizing articles of law and more about operationalizing them under business constraints.
Additionally, sharpen your understanding of global frameworks—GDPR, CCPA, and the APAC privacy principles—since multinational clients expect harmonized advice.
